GS4B012212DCT Description

GS4B012212DCT Description

The GS4B012212DCT from TT Electronics/IRC is a high-precision 7-resistor thin film network designed for surface-mount applications. Encased in a ceramic SOIC-8 package, it features a 22.1KΩ resistance value per resistor with a tight ±0.5% tolerance and a ±100ppm/°C temperature coefficient, ensuring stability across a wide operating range (70°C to 125°C). With a 0.4W total power rating (0.05W per resistor) and a 100V maximum voltage rating, this network is engineered for reliability in demanding circuits. Its gull-wing termination and 1.27mm terminal pitch facilitate easy PCB integration, while the ceramic substrate enhances thermal performance.

GS4B012212DCT Features

  • Precision Thin Film Technology: Delivers low noise and high accuracy (±0.5%) for sensitive analog/digital circuits.
  • Robust Ceramic Package: Superior heat dissipation and mechanical strength vs. plastic alternatives.
  • BUS Circuit Designator: Optimized for bus termination, voltage division, and pull-up/down applications.
  • Space-Efficient SOIC-8: Compact footprint (4.9mm x 5.99mm x 1.45mm) with ±0.1mm length/height tolerances.
  • Automotive-Grade Alternatives: While not PPAP-certified, its 125°C max temperature suits industrial and telecom environments.
  • Non-RoHS Compliance: Ideal for legacy systems requiring leaded components.
